GeForce RTX 4080 Ti vs Radeon Pro Vega II Duo

We compared two Desktop platform GPUs: 16GB VRAM GeForce RTX 4080 Ti and 32GB VRAM Radeon Pro Vega II Duo to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

GeForce RTX 4080 Ti Advantages
Boost Clock has increased by 52% (2610MHz vs 1720MHz)
9984 additional rendering cores
Lower TDP (400W vs 475W)
Radeon Pro Vega II Duo Advantages
More VRAM (32GB vs 16GB)
Larger VRAM bandwidth (1020GB/s vs 678.4GB/s)
